Claims (10)
- (ⅰ) 폴리아미드 부분(A)와 폴리에스테르 부분(B)으로 구성된 분할형 필라멘트 복합사를 경사 및 위사 중 적어도 어느 하나로 사용하여 직물을 제조하는 제직 공정;(ⅱ) 제조된 직물을 페놀계 약제가 포함된 100~120℃의 열수로 처리하는 수축공정; 및(ⅲ) 제조된 직물을 알칼리 수용액으로 처리하여 직물 내 상기 분할형 필라멘트 복합사를 분할시키는 분할공정; 을 포함하는 것을 특징으로 하는 연마용 직물의 제조방법.
- 제1항에 있어서, 상기 수축 공정에서 사용되는 페놀계 약제가 포함된 열수내 페놀계 약제의 농도는 1~10중량%인 것을 특징으로 하는 연마용 직물의 제조방법.
- 제1항 또는 제2항에 있어서, 페놀계 약제는 벤질알콜 및 페놀 중에서 선택된 1종인 것을 특징으로 하는 연마용 직물의 제조방법.
- 제1항에 있어서, 상기 수축공정에서 직물의 폭을 30~50% 수축시키는 것을 특징으로 하는 연마용 직물의 제조방법.
- 제1항에 있어서, 상기 수축공정에서 직물의 두께를 100~300% 신장시키는 것을 특징으로 하는 연마용 직물의 제조방법.
- 제1항에 있어서, 분할공정에서 사용되는 알칼리 수용액은 가성소다 수용액인 것을 특징으로 하는 연마용 직물의 제조방법.
- 제5항에 있어서, 가성소다 수용액내 가성소다 농도는 0.3~3중량%인 것을 특징으로 하는 연마용 직물의 제조방법.
- 제1항에 있어서, 상기 제직공정에서 경사로는 폴리아미드 필라멘트 및 폴리에스테르 필라멘트 중에서 선택된 1종을 사용하고 위사로는 상기 분할형 필라멘트 복합사를 사용하는 것을 특징으로 하는 연마용 직물의 제조방법.
- 제1항에 있어서, 분할형 필라멘트 복합사 내 폴리에스테르 부분(B)의 함량이 상기 복합사 전체중량대비 60~80중량%인 것을 특징으로 하는 연마용 직물의 제조방법.
- 제1항에 있어서, 상기 폴리에스테르 부분(B)의 분할 후 섬도가 0.1~0.4 데니어이고, 상기 폴리아미드 부분(A)의 분할 후 섬도가 0.02~0.1데니어인 것을 특징으로 하는 직물의 제조방법.
